Saddle Up

Southwest Alberta is horse country. Community rodeo is the social event of the year in many communities. Wranglers herd cattle from the rangelands in late autumn. Here, hand-tooled leather is still stiched with century-old machinery for working cowboys who are happy to wait more than a year to pay $5,000 for a unique saddle.
The short, muscular quarterhorse is the breed of choice for its exceptional professionalism and sweet temper.
Riding opportunities abound, from day rides through flowered foothills to long days in the saddle at the several working ranchs that welcome vacationing visitors to bunk down for days at a time.
